1. Steel and Iron Suppliers
Major Players:
Nucor and Steel Dynamics
What Sets Them Apart:
Large-Scale Production
These companies make millions of tons of steel each year. This helps them meet big orders easily.
Eco-Friendly Practices
Nucor uses recycled steel and clean energy. This is better for the environment and helps customers reduce their carbon footprint.
2. Aluminum Suppliers
Top Companies:
Alcoa and Novelis
Specializations:
Aerospace-Grade Aluminum
These companies supply strong yet lightweight aluminum, perfect for planes and high-speed vehicles.
Recycling Initiatives
Novelis is known for turning scrap into high-quality aluminum, saving energy and reducing waste.
3. Specialty Metal Suppliers
Focus Areas:
Titanium, nickel alloys, and high-performance metals
Notable Firms:
Carpenter Technology and ATI (Allegheny Technologies)
Why They Matter:
These companies serve aerospace, defense, and medical industries where metal strength and performance are critical. They provide custom-engineered solutions for complex parts.
